Concordia University, Nebraska men's basketball coach Grant Schmidt announced that Tyler Byrd of Bennington High School will play basketball for the Bulldogs beginning next season. "Tyler will bring so many great things to our program," said Schmidt. "He possesses the athleticism and leadership you look for in a point guard. His background as a quarterback in football translates well to his leadership on the court. His basketball IQ as well as his work ethic will allow him to step in and contribute immediately."
A four-year letter winner at Bennington, Byrd was named all-conference second team as a junior. A two-sport athlete for the Badgers he was also an all-state and all-conference player in football. He was named to first team all-district, first team all-Omaha area, and first team all-state as a quarterback.
As the starting point guard for the Badgers, Byrd helped lead them to an impressive 23-0 record and birth in the Class C Nebraska State Championship Tournament.
"Tyler's personality on and off the court will mesh so well with the guys we have that he is a perfect fit for us right now," Schmidt added. "(Byrd) is so well rounded with the type of person he is in the classroom and on the court I'm very excited to have him join our program."
Byrd's resume in the classroom is as impressive as his abilities on the court. He has been on the honor roll each year and carries a 4.0 grade point average. Byrd is a two-time academic all-state selection by the NSAA.
